CHAFFIN LOOKING FOR STRONG RUN AT LOCAL TRACK

MOORESVILLE, North Carolina (June 25, 2008) – Driver Chad Chaffin is looking for a great run at one of his local tracks, Memphis Motorsports Park. The Murfreesboro, Tennessee native will take battle with his fellow Truck drivers as the NASCAR Craftsman Truck Series prepares for the O’Reilly 200 this Saturday night.

This weekend will mark Chaffin’s seventh start in the Truck Series at Memphis Motorsports Park, and Key Motorsports’ third. After an unfortunate late race accident spoiled a good run by rookie Paul Poulter at the Milwaukee Mile, the #40 Key Motorsports Chevrolet is looking to bounce back this week with Chaffin back at the wheel.

“Honestly, I just look forward to every race, but I am excited about Memphis,” stated Chaffin. “This is one of the local tracks, one I’ve been on many times. It will be very hot, which may be the only thing I am not looking forward to, but it’s always great racing at Memphis.”

Crew Chief Lance Hooper could not agree more. “We are looking for a great run this weekend, especially with this being one of Chad’s home tracks. He has qualified and run well at Memphis, and we are looking to keep that going.”

This weekend will also mark the first race for Key Motorsports at Memphis Motorsports Park in which Chaffin will steer the #40 Chevrolet Silverado.

KEY MOTORSPORTS RACE STATS (MEMPHIS): PREVIOUS STARTS: 2 BEST START: 30th (2007) BEST FINISH: 24th (2007) LAPS LED: - WINNINGS: $17,690 PREVIOUS MEMPHIS RACE RESULTS: (June 30, 2007) ST: 30th FIN: 24th Winnings: $9175

CHAD CHAFFIN RACE STATS (MEMPHIS): PREVIOUS STARTS: 6 BEST START: 2nd (2003) BEST FINISH: 4th (2001) LAPS LED: - WINNINGS: $61, 910 PREVIOUS MEMPHIS RACE RESULTS: (July 15, 2006) ST: 24th FIN: 29th Winnings: $8, 565
